摘要
Induction motors are widely applied in the fields of industry with the merits of simple structure, stable performance and convenient manufacturing. However, in some servos with high reliability requirements, the installation of the speed sensor not only increases the volume and the weight, but also reduces the reliability of the driving system. To solve this problem, speed-sensorless technique has gained an increasing number of attention and research. This paper proposes the adaptive full-order (AFO) observer based on bilinear transformation, simulation has been done to prove the effectiveness.
